Wondered if you can guys can help. The father in laws doblo seems to have lost power to the driver side brake light.

This is believe it due to the a tow bar fitment that has been on for a few years.

The tow bar electrics have been spliced into the driver side rear cluster cabling.

Any ideas where i should start. The fuses are fine just alittle lost moving forward.
The bulb is showing as connected but no brake lights as you disconnect it then shows a warning light that there is no bulb.

Very weird. Still have this fault.
Checked 12v down on switch wire to bulb holder no lamp illumination.
Disconnect and alarms that no lamp connected.

Connect a 12v battery to rear light and lights up no problem.
Connect a cable from passenger brake light over the driver brake light also no problem.

So very lost, there's voltage but no lamp illumination.
 
Try taking the splice off that wire, cutting it and remaking it as a solid wire (ie strip a bit, make a good twist joint and insulate it, or use a suitable crimp connector.

Now try the light. If it works, remake the crimp further down. I had similar on another motor, but don't ask me what exactly caused it. It's worth going round all your earths as well - they seem prone to degrading on towbar electrics.
